1. Blooming Flowers
- Age Appropriate: 4-7 years; simple flower designs with large areas to color.
- Skills Developed: Fine motor skills, hand-eye coordination, and basic shape recognition.
- Colors Recommended: Bright greens for stems and leaves, pastel shades like pink, yellow, and purple for tulips, and yellow with white for daisies.
2. Happy Bees and Butterflies
- Age Appropriate: 5-8 years; includes more detailed bees and smiling flowers, adding a playful element.
- Skills Developed: Attention to detail, creativity in coloring patterns, and emotional recognition through smiling faces.
- Colors Recommended: Yellow and black for bees, green for grass and stems, and sunny yellow with white for daisies.
3. Cute Baby Animals
- Age Appropriate: 3-6 years; cute animals with simple outlines in a meadow setting.
- Skills Developed: Color differentiation, storytelling through animal expressions, and spatial awareness.
- Colors Recommended: White or light gray for sheep and bunny, green for grass, and soft blues for the sky background.
4. Rainbow with Clouds
- Age Appropriate: 3-5 years; very simple design with large sections for coloring.
- Skills Developed: Color recognition (rainbow sequence), basic motor skills, and creativity in cloud shading.
- Colors Recommended: Red, orange, yellow, green, blue, indigo, and violet for the rainbow; light gray or blue for clouds.
5. Garden Tools and Flowers
- Age Appropriate: 4-7 years; simple daisy flowers with large petals and minimal detail.
- Skills Developed: Fine motor skills, shape recognition, and creativity in coloring repetitive patterns.
- Colors Recommended: Green for stems and leaves, white or light yellow for daisy petals, and bright yellow for the flower centers.
6. Easter Eggs and Basket
- Age Appropriate: 5-8 years; features a basket with patterned eggs, adding some complexity.
- Skills Developed: Pattern recognition, hand-eye coordination, and creativity in coloring diverse egg designs.
- Colors Recommended: Brown or beige for the basket, and a variety of pastel colors like pink, blue, yellow, and lavender for the eggs.
7. Sunny Day with Trees and Birds
- Age Appropriate: 6-9 years; more detailed with a tree, birds, and background elements like the sun and clouds.
- Skills Developed: Attention to detail, storytelling through nature scenes, and emotional recognition with the smiling sun.
- Colors Recommended: Green for tree leaves, brown for the trunk, blue for birds, yellow for the sun, and light gray or blue for clouds.
